Reynolds Nature Preserve

Reynolds Nature Preserve
July 31, 2021 by Shawn Taylor in parks

Address: 5665 Reynolds Road, Morrow, Ga 30260
Cost of admission: None
Governance: Clayton County Parks and Recreation
Acres: 146
Approximate miles of trails: 3
Hours: 8:00am to dusk daily (Interpretive Center is open 8:00am to 5:00pm, Monday to Friday)
Miles from downtown Atlanta: 12
MARTA directions: Take the 193 from East Point station to Jonesboro Rd @ Westwood Way. From there, walk west on Westwood Way. The road deadends into the Morrow Pathway. Take the path to its end at Reynolds Road. One entrance to the preserve is directly across Reynolds Road from where the path intersects it.
Parking: There are multiple preserve parking areas along Reynolds Road. There are bike racks located at the interpretive center and at the third trailhead listed below.
Trailhead(s): There are multiple trailheads:

  1. The main entrance is at the interpretive center, at 33.6011169,-84.3470463.

  2. A second parking lot is at 33.5974665,-84.3436243, and you can access the trail here.

  3. A third trailhead is located at the south end of the park along Reynolds Road, at 33.5955272,-84.343485.

Trail surface: Natural

Amenities:

  • Interpretive Center (8-5 Monday-Friday)

  • Bike racks (at first and third trailheads mentioned above)

  • Restrooms (in the interpretive center; were open on a weekend when I visited, even though the center was not)

  • Demonstration garden
